Switch 2 Powers Up Mario Kart World Racing Thrills

Experience the New Switch 2 and Mario Kart World

Cruising through Bowser’s Castle with Toad in Mario Kart World is anything but calm. The track is packed with lava pits, banana peels, and turtle shells, creating chaos for all 25 racers. This intense gameplay highlights why the new Switch 2 is a game-changer for fans who crave smooth, fast-paced action.

The Switch 2 elevates gaming with a larger 7.9-inch screen, upgraded from the original 6.2 inches, and a sharper 1020p resolution. While it doesn’t match the OLED screens’ brilliance, it offers a cleaner, more vibrant display than before. Plus, when connected to an HDTV, it supports stunning 4K and HDR visuals, making Mario Kart World look better than ever.

Enhanced Graphics and Performance for Mario Kart World

Nintendo has long prioritized gameplay quality over raw power, but the Switch 2 marks a significant step up. Previous titles like The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om sometimes suffered from blurry graphics and slow frame rates. Now, the Switch 2 delivers a smoother experience with 120 frames per second, reducing fuzziness and enhancing fluidity.

Though it doesn’t rival the PlayStation 5 or Xbox Series X in sheer graphical power, it more than meets the needs of Mario Kart World and similar titles. Gamers will appreciate the balance between performance and portability.

More Storage and Refined Controls

Storage is no longer an issue. The Switch 2 offers a massive 256 GB of internal memory, eight times that of the original Switch. Still, for large game files, players might want to invest in a microSD Express card, which costs a bit more but ensures ample space.

The Joy-Con controllers have also been reworked. They attach magnetically to the console, providing a satisfying click. Both controllers now include an optical mouse feature, allowing players to roll them on surfaces for added control options. This innovation may be especially useful in strategy games like Civilization VII, recently ported to the Switch 2.

New Social Features in Switch 2

Social gaming takes a leap with a dedicated “C” button on the right Joy-Con that activates GameChat. Players can easily connect and chat with friends without needing a subscription until March 31, 2026. The built-in microphone supports voice chat, while video chat requires a separate Nintendo camera.

Another highlight is GameShare, which lets users play certain games together even if one player doesn’t own the title. While these features bring Nintendo closer to competitors like PlayStation and Xbox, some gamers already familiar with Fortnite or Minecraft might find these updates a bit late.

Game Library and Future Prospects

The big question remains: does the Switch 2 have compelling games? Currently, only a few exclusives like Mario Kart World and Nintendo Switch 2 Welcome Tour are available. The console also supports ports of popular titles such as Cyberpunk 2077 and offers upgrades for classics like the latest Zelda games.

Backward compatibility allows players to enjoy the vast Switch library and older favorites. Future exclusives featuring beloved characters like Donkey Kong and Kirby are planned, promising exciting times ahead.

Competition and Market Position

Nintendo faces stiff competition not just from traditional consoles like PlayStation and Xbox but also from handheld rivals. Valve’s SteamDeck offers a vast PC game library at a lower price, while Microsoft partners with Asus to release the ROG Xbox Ally handheld device before the year ends.

In time, developers will better unlock the Switch 2’s potential. For now, those eager to jump back into the world of Mario, Luigi, and Princess Peach know exactly what to do.
